The Danakil Depression is a dramatic geological wonder formed by the separation of three tectonic plates, creating one of the most extreme and otherworldly landscapes on Earth. Located deep below sea level, this vast depression is shaped by constant volcanic and geothermal activity, making it a living showcase of the planet’s raw power. Its unique formation has resulted in an environment unlike anywhere else, where the Earth’s crust is actively pulling apart beneath your feet. Renowned as the “hottest place on the planet,” the Danakil Depression is a surreal mosaic of salt flats, vivid mineral deposits, bubbling acidic springs, lava lakes, and towering volcanoes. Brilliant yellows, greens, and reds stain the ground, creating an almost alien scenery that feels more like another planet than Earth. Harsh, beautiful, and awe-inspiring, the Danakil Depression offers a rare glimpse into the forces that shape our world and stands as one of nature’s most extraordinary spectacles.

Eco Tour at Erta Ale. After visiting the attractions: Continue driving to Erta Ale, one of Ethiopia’s most captivating and physically demanding natural wonders. Erta Ale is a shield volcano with a base diameter of 30 km and a 1 km² caldera at the summit. It holds the world’s only permanent lava lake and sits at an altitude of 613 meters. The drive takes about 4 hours through a dramatic landscape of solidified lava and desert sand, passing scattered hamlets along the way.
